An annual business education program for young, African-American entrepreneurs opens this week at Walt Disney World’s Swan and Dolphin Resort in Lake Buena Vista, Fla., organizers said Tuesday.

The Black Enterprise Kidpreneur/Teenpreneur Conference aims to give young people all the tools required to run a successful small businesses, including workshops geared towards would-be entrepreneurs between 7 and 17 years old.

“This top-notch, step-by-step program covers everything from creating a business plan to actually establishing and managing a mini-company,” Black Enterprise vice president Alfred Edmond Jr. said in a statement.

This year’s conference begins May 10.
